My power locks where working from my keyfob and door switch's. I live in indiana and went down to the local Zbart place and had them put on a remote starter from audio vox. A code alarm ca5054. Remote start works fine. Power locks from new keyfob worked fine for a day now they dont work from fob or both door switch's. Took it back to Zbart and they said the code alarm was pulsing fine so it had to be another problem. They basically said figure it out yourself because it wasnt the install or the code alarm equipment. WTF!!! My dome light doesnt work either. This is my first remote starter.

The dome lamp fuse is #12 in the junction block on the side of the dash. It may be related to the lock problem.

The Dakota uses a 2 wire system for the door locks. Zbart likely put a relay into the system - where, I don't know. I can't find a manual for the system online.

Basically, I'd take it back and tell them to fix it. If they don't, contact your credit card company or go to small claims court.
